To identify loud plumbing, it is necessary to determine first whether the unwanted sounds occur on the system's inlet side-in other words, when water is turned on-or on the drainpipe side. Sounds on the inlet side have actually differed causes: excessive water pressure, worn valve and tap components, incorrectly linked pumps or other devices, incorrectly placed pipeline fasteners, and plumbing runs having way too many tight bends or various other limitations. Noises on the drainpipe side usually originate from inadequate place or, similar to some inlet side sound, a layout including tight bends.
Hissing
Hissing noise that occurs when a faucet is opened a little normally signals excessive water stress. Consult your neighborhood water company if you believe this problem; it will certainly be able to tell you the water stress in your area as well as can mount a pressurereducing valve on the incoming water system pipeline if needed.
Thudding
Thudding sound, commonly accompanied by shivering pipes, when a faucet or appliance valve is turned off is a condition called water hammer. The noise and also resonance are triggered by the resounding wave of stress in the water, which instantly has no location to go. Often opening up a shutoff that releases water rapidly into a section of piping having a constraint, arm joint, or tee fitting can create the same problem.
Water hammer can usually be healed by setting up fittings called air chambers or shock absorbers in the plumbing to which the trouble shutoffs or taps are linked. These gadgets enable the shock wave created by the halted circulation of water to dissipate in the air they include, which (unlike water) is compressible.
Older plumbing systems may have short vertical areas of capped pipeline behind wall surfaces on tap runs for the exact same purpose; these can at some point fill with water, lowering or damaging their performance. The cure is to drain pipes the water system entirely by shutting off the main water valve and opening all faucets. After that open the main supply valve and also close the faucets individually, beginning with the faucet nearest the shutoff as well as ending with the one farthest away.
Chattering or Shrilling
Extreme chattering or screeching that happens when a shutoff or faucet is activated, which typically goes away when the fitting is opened completely, signals loosened or malfunctioning internal parts. The remedy is to change the shutoff or faucet with a brand-new one.
Pumps and also home appliances such as washing equipments as well as dishwashing machines can transfer electric motor noise to pipelines if they are incorrectly attached. Link such things to plumbing with plastic or rubber hoses-never rigid pipe-to isolate them.
Various Other Inlet Side Noises
Creaking, squealing, scratching, breaking, as well as touching typically are brought on by the expansion or contraction of pipelines, generally copper ones supplying warm water. The noises happen as the pipelines slide against loose fasteners or strike close-by residence framing. You can commonly determine the area of the issue if the pipes are exposed; simply follow the noise when the pipelines are making noise. More than likely you will find a loosened pipeline wall mount or a location where pipes lie so close to floor joists or other mounting items that they clatter versus them. Attaching foam pipeline insulation around the pipelines at the point of call need to treat the trouble. Make sure straps and wall mounts are safe as well as provide ample assistance. Where feasible, pipeline fasteners need to be connected to enormous structural components such as foundation walls as opposed to to framing; doing so decreases the transmission of vibrations from plumbing to surface areas that can enhance and also transfer them. If affixing fasteners to framework is unavoidable, wrap pipelines with insulation or various other resilient material where they call bolts, and sandwich the ends of new bolts in between rubber washing machines when installing them.
Correcting plumbing runs that struggle with flow-restricting limited or various bends is a last resource that ought to be undertaken only after getting in touch with a proficient plumbing professional. However, this circumstance is rather typical in older houses that may not have been developed with interior plumbing or that have seen a number of remodels, specifically by beginners.
Drain Sound
On the drainpipe side of plumbing, the chief goals are to eliminate surfaces that can be struck by dropping or hurrying water as well as to shield pipes to include inevitable sounds.
In brand-new building, tubs, shower stalls, commodes, as well as wallmounted sinks and also containers ought to be set on or versus durable underlayments to decrease the transmission of noise via them. Water-saving bathrooms and also faucets are less loud than traditional models; mount them rather than older types even if codes in your location still allow making use of older components.
Drainpipes that do not run up and down to the basement or that branch right into straight pipe runs supported at floor joists or other mounting present specifically problematic noise problems. Such pipes are large enough to emit substantial resonance; they likewise lug significant amounts of water, which makes the situation worse. In brand-new building, specify cast-iron soil pipelines (the huge pipelines that drain commodes) if you can afford them. Their enormity contains much of the noise made by water travelling through them. Also, prevent directing drains in walls shown to bedrooms and spaces where people gather. Walls containing drainpipes ought to be soundproofed as was explained earlier, making use of dual panels of sound-insulating fiberboard and wallboard. Pipelines themselves can be wrapped with special fiberglass insulation created the purpose; such pipes have an impervious plastic skin (in some cases consisting of lead). Outcomes are not always sufficient.
WHY IS MY PLUMBING MAKING SO MUCH NOISE?
This noise indeed sounds like someone is banging a hammer against your pipes! It happens when a faucet is opened, allowed to run for a bit, then quickly shut — causing the rushing water to slam against the shut-off valve.
To remedy this, you’ll need to check and refill your air chamber. Air chambers are filled with — you guessed it — air and help absorb the shock of moving water (that comes to a sudden stop). Over time, these chambers can fill with water, making them less effective.

Cracks or Ticks
Cracking or ticking typically comes from hot water going through cold, copper pipes. This causes the copper to expand resulting in a cracking or ticking sound. Once the pipes stop expanding, the noise should stop as well.
Pro tip: you may want to lower the temperature of your water heater to see if that helps lessen the sound, or wrapping the pipe in insulation can also help muffle the noise.
Bangs
Bangs typically come from water pressure that’s too high. To test for high water pressure, get a pressure gauge and attach it to your faucet. Water pressure should be no higher than 80 psi (pounds per square inch) and also no lower than 40 psi. If you find a number greater than 80 psi, then you’ve found your problem!
